Output b3b598dae36229da665246bf3d846a8be6b6f06c3442c46d83c75f52249adeae:1

value
28788130
script pubkey
OP_0 OP_PUSHBYTES_20 0f95bfbe60c4414141a96cac807fd4b6b8738119
address
bc1qp72ml0nqc3q5zsdfdjkgql75k6u88qgeftued2
transaction
b3b598dae36229da665246bf3d846a8be6b6f06c3442c46d83c75f52249adeae
confirmations
90844
spent
true